About Gregory S. Nusinovich

Gregory S. Nusinovich is a scholar working on Atomic and Molecular Physics, and Optics, Aerospace Engineering and Nuclear and High Energy Physics, having authored 396 papers that have together received 6.3k indexed citations. Recurring topics across this work include Gyrotron and Vacuum Electronics Research (319 papers), Particle accelerators and beam dynamics (234 papers) and Pulsed Power Technology Applications (105 papers). The work is most often cited by research in Atomic and Molecular Physics, and Optics (5.8k citations), Aerospace Engineering (3.0k citations) and Control and Systems Engineering (2.3k citations). Gregory S. Nusinovich has collaborated with scholars based in United States, Russia and Latvia. Frequent co-authors include Thomas M. Antonsen, Steven H. Gold, O. Dumbrajs, N. S. Ginzburg, V.L. Granatstein, M. I. Petelin, Oleksandr V. Sinitsyn, Alexander N. Vlasov, Neville C. Luhmann and John H. Booske.
